First thing is you do not have Step/Dir inputs on the drives, they will be analogue +/-10v, that is why you will need to use an IP-A controller.
The TG will be Tacho Generator, basically a means of the drive knowing the rotational speed of the motor and will be integral to the motor and will come out on two wires.
In the above drawing it looks like you have an encoder also on the motor, the B A C D E F wires, can you find them in the cabinet as they likely go to the drive and could well be Encoder signals. I would assume C and D are the power to the encoder and A and B are the A and B channels of the encoder but not sure about E and F. If there had been another wire I would have said it was hall signals, maybe the manual will shed some more light on it.
